3.1 Tools and Equipment Needed
To assemble your ProForm elliptical, gather the necessary tools and equipment. You will need an Allen wrench (3mm and 5mm), a Phillips screwdriver, and a flathead screwdriver. Pliers and a socket set may also be required for certain bolts. Ensure you have a rubber mallet for aligning parts without causing damage. Safety gear, such as gloves and safety glasses, is recommended to protect yourself during assembly. All tools are typically included in the elliptical package, but verify before starting. Properly organize the tools to streamline the process and avoid delays. Missing tools may require a visit to a hardware store.
3.2 Step-by-Step Assembly Instructions
Begin by carefully unboxing and organizing all components. Attach the stabilizer bars to the elliptical frame using the provided bolts and an Allen wrench. Next, secure the handlebars to the upright posts, ensuring tightness. Install the pedals by aligning the crank arms and tightening the pedals firmly. Mount the console to the handlebar post, connecting all necessary wires. Finally, attach the footplates to the pedals and ensure all bolts are tightened properly. Refer to the diagrams in the manual for precise alignment. Double-check all connections and ensure the elliptical is stable before use. Proper assembly is critical for safety and functionality.

5.1 Cleaning and Upkeep
Regular cleaning is essential to maintain your ProForm elliptical’s performance and longevity.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e down the frame, handles, and console after each use. For tougher dirt or sweat residue, dampen the cloth with water, but av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as they may damage the finish. Clean the pedals and moving parts with a mild detergent and dry thoroughly to prevent rust. Dust and debris should be vacuumed from the machine’s underside periodically to ensure smooth operation; Always unplug the elliptical before cleaning electrical components, and avoid spraying liquids directly onto the console or controls. Regular upkeep helps prevent mechanical issues and ensures a safe, effective workout experience.
5.2 Lubrication and Parts Inspection
Regular lubrication is crucial for maintaining smooth operation and preventing wear on moving parts. Apply silicone-based lubricant to the flywheel and pedal axles every 3–6 months or as needed. Inspect all bolts and screws periodically to ensure they are tight and secure. Check for worn or damaged parts, such as pedals, handlebars, or cables, and replace them immediately if necessary. Examine the elliptical’s frame for signs of rust or corrosion and treat promptly. For optimal performance, refer to the manual for specific lubrication points and maintenance schedules. Avoid over-lubrication, as it may attract dust and dirt. Regular inspections ensure safety and prolong the lifespan of your ProForm elliptical.

6.2 Resetting and Repairing
To reset your ProForm elliptical, unplug it from the power source, wait 30 seconds, and plug it back in. This often resolves software glitches. For mechanical issues, check for loose bolts or misaligned parts. Lubricate moving components if squeaking occurs. If the console is unresponsive, ensure all connections are secure. For complex repairs, refer to the troubleshooting guide or contact ProForm support. Never attempt repairs while the machine is in operation. Always follow safety precautions to avoid injury. If issues persist, professional assistance may be required to ensure proper functionality and safety.
